Hello All, We have survived all the way to
Lake Garda where we have a hotel overlooking a marina and boats! (just in case
we'd forgotten what they look like)
We had a super cabin on board the Stena Hellanica
and a great view from the huge porthole as we arrived at the hook of holland
early in the morning. We were off the ferry quite quickly and immediately
into the right hand driving and tom tom giving us valuable instructions.
It was a nice dry day and we made good progress south. Looking at
the map we decided a first night stop might be in Wiesbaden. (Lynette used
to live there and I knew it was quite pretty). Using the Bubbs
trusty hotel guide we eventually found our way to the right place only to be
told it was some sort of congress week and all the hotels were FULL. Doh!
back in the car and a quick look at the map and book again and we went on to
Darnstadt. (Sadly Darnstadt was not pretty but it did have a pretty
good hotel rooom!) Also- next door was an Aussie
pizzeria? We had to try one! In case you're wondering an Aussie pizza
is not as good as an Italian but Huge! Had a lovely restful
night with a good breakfast the next morning and set off towards the Brenner
Pass and intending to stay in Innsbruck.
All went well with me doing some of the driving and
coping (just) with some of the hundreds of lorries on the inside lane and the
aggressive German motor cars steaming up behind us at speeds of over 100 mph. on
roads no better than the A12.. Getting into Innsbruck we had a few
arguments with the tom tom as we searched for the hotel. Graham did well
in the end and dived into the underground car park of the hotel as he spotted it
at the last moment. We thought we had it all sorted only to find
that again Innsbruck was FULL! No room at the inn so back in the car and
continued on to the Brenner Pass. We stopped at a rest station which was
supposed to be a tourist information place as well. Wrong! just a lady
selling coffee but we asked about places off the main road and she said take the
next exit and try. That was a good move so we spent the night in a
village in the mountains (see picture) and it was a lovely family run hotel and
I managed most of my lovely home cooked wiener schnitzel! (It was almost
as big as my Aussie pizza!
Next morning - after a continental breakfast - we
said goodbye to the parrot (He lived in the hall) and set off back on to the
main (toll) road through the Brenner Pass and Dolomites - at some point
going from Austria into Italy. The weather got sunnier and warmer as we
drove south and headed to Verona which we fancied seeing. Well we
saw some of it but guess what - Verona was having some sort of festival and it
was FULL. The lady in the hotel told Graham she would go to
Peschiera. (?) We got back to the driving and just a few
kilometers later we were looking at a pretty town on the edge of Lake Garda -
see pictures. So here we are near the marina and have enjoyed a long walk
along the lake and an Italian ice cream.
Tomorrow we set off to Venice where we know there
is a hotel room for two nights with our name on it no matter what
congress/festival is in town!
